net/net: Add SocketReadState for reuse codes

This function is from net/socket.c, move it to net.c and net.h.
Add SocketReadState to make others reuse net_fill_rstate().
suggestion from jason.

void net_socket_rs_init(SocketReadState *rs,
SocketReadStateFinalize *finalize)
{
rs->state = 0;
rs->index = 0;
rs->packet_len = 0;
memset(rs->buf, 0, sizeof(rs->buf));
rs->finalize = finalize;
}
/*
* Returns
* 0: SocketReadState is not ready
* 1: SocketReadState is ready
* otherwise error occurs
*/
int net_fill_rstate(SocketReadState *rs, const uint8_t *buf, int size)
{
unsigned int l;
while (size > 0) {
/* reassemble a packet from the network */
switch (rs->state) { /* 0 = getting length, 1 = getting data */
case 0:
l = 4 - rs->index;
if (l > size) {
l = size;
}
memcpy(rs->buf + rs->index, buf, l);
buf += l;
size -= l;
rs->index += l;
if (rs->index == 4) {
/* got length */
rs->packet_len = ntohl(*(uint32_t *)rs->buf);
rs->index = 0;
rs->state = 1;
}
break;
case 1:
l = rs->packet_len - rs->index;
if (l > size) {
l = size;
}
if (rs->index + l <= sizeof(rs->buf)) {
memcpy(rs->buf + rs->index, buf, l);
} else {
fprintf(stderr, "serious error: oversized packet received,"
"connection terminated.\n");
rs->index = rs->state = 0;
return -1;
}
rs->index += l;
buf += l;
size -= l;
if (rs->index >= rs->packet_len) {
rs->index = 0;
rs->state = 0;
if (rs->finalize) {
rs->finalize(rs);
}
return 1;
}
break;
}
}
return 0;
}
